In this review of the BPMIO 5000pa Robot Vacuum and Mop Combo the bottom line is simple: this model is for families and pet owners who want a single robot that vacuums, mops and navigates large homes reliably. The standout reason to buy is the combination of a powerful 5000Pa suction motor with LiDAR navigation, which translates to deeper carpet cleaning and accurate mapping across multiple floors. Setup and daily use are straightforward via the Tuya Smart Life app and voice assistants, making it a practical daily helper rather than a one-off gadget.
Key Features
- 5000Pa Strong Suction: A Japanese BIDC brushless motor provides adjustable suction that automatically boosts on carpets for deeper dirt removal.
- Advanced LiDAR Navigation: 360 scanning and rapid mapping create accurate floor plans so the robot follows efficient, consistent cleaning routes.
- 3-in-1 Cleaning: Side brushes, V-shaped roller and a Y-shaped mopping system let the robot sweep, vacuum and mop without frequent manual intervention.
- Multi-Map Support: Save up to five maps and set room sequences, which is useful for homes with multiple floors or different cleaning needs.
- App and Voice Control: The Tuya Smart Life app and Alexa/Google Assistant support scheduling, suction and water-level control plus 30 virtual no-go zones.
- Long Runtime and Auto Recharge: Runs 90 to 150 minutes depending on settings and returns to the dock to recharge automatically to finish large jobs.
Who It's For
The BPMIO B15 is best for busy households with pets or mixed floor types where strong suction and scheduled, hands-off cleaning matter. It suits owners who want precise navigation and map control, including the ability to block off pet beds or kids play areas with up to 30 no-go zones.
It is less ideal for people who need support for 5 GHz Wi-Fi or those who prefer ultra-compact units for very small apartments. Users who want a self-emptying dock or integrated mop water disposal will need a different model or accessory, because this unit uses a manual dustbin and an electronically controlled 250ml water tank.

Specifications
| Brand | BPMIO |
| Suction Power | Up to 5000Pa (adjustable) |
| Navigation | LiDAR / LDS 360 scanning |
| Maps | Save up to 5 floor maps, 30 no-go zones |
| Dust Bin / Water Tank | 340ml dust box / 250ml electronically controlled water tank |
| Runtime | Approximately 90-150 min (depends on mode) |
| Obstacle Clearance | Up to 18mm, supports 15 degree slope |
